Lee USA Speedway Hosts BRMS Night at the Races

Lee, NH - 6/21/25 – A packed crowd turned out Friday night at Lee USA Speedway for BRMS Night at the Races, and they were treated to an exciting slate of action across four divisions: Super Streets, Ridge Runners, Pro Stocks, and Mighty Trucks (with a Beetle Bug twist).

The 50-lap Summer Six Pack Super Streets main event was a show of endurance and consistency, with Matt Sonnhalter (VT33) of White River Junction, VT prevailing at the end of a long green-flag stretch. Sonnhalter charged from the middle of the pack and fought off a determined run from Corey Fanning (Mapleville, RI), who crossed the line second after climbing five positions. Rochester’s Cam Huntress (42) completed the podium in third, while Donald Belisle (7) of Merrimack and Chris Riendeau (VT4) of Ascutney, VT rounded out the top five. Heat race victories went to Milton Duran (12) and Huntress (42), but neither could hold off Sonnhalter when it mattered most.

The Ridge Runner division produced one of the most action-packed features of the night, with Gage Osborne (55) of Plaistow, NH leading the way to a dominant victory. Osborne set the pace early and never faltered over 20 laps. Behind him, Zacary Fraser (37Z) of Nottingham, NH charged forward seven spots to claim second, followed by Callie Osborne (77) of Hudson, NH in third. Stone Slattery (99) of Pelham impressed with an eight-position climb to finish fourth, and Dwight Souther Jr. (23) of Seabrook, NH capped the top five. Heat race wins went to Gage Osborne (55) and Brian Caswell (47).

The headline Pro Stock 60-lap feature saw Jimmy Renfrew Jr. (00) of Candia, NH drive a flawless race, holding off some of the region’s top talent for the checkered flag. Nicholas Cusack (2) of Scarborough, ME, who earlier set fast time in qualifying at 14.981 seconds, settled for second after starting on pole. Casey Call (90) of Pembroke, NH crossed the line third, followed by Dave Farrington Jr. (23) of Sabattus, ME and Ryan Green (93) of Berwick, ME. Rounding out the top ten were Bobby Baillargeon (82), Cole Robie (29), Corey Bubar (12X), Connor McDougal (8), and Frankie Eldredge (09).

The Mighty Trucks capped off the evening with a thrilling 20-lap shootout. Shane Webber (7) of New Vineyard, ME – one of the only Beetle Bugs in attendance – joined the field and ran head-to-head with the trucks while being scored separately. Webber proved he could more than hold his own, taking the overall race win in convincing style. Among the trucks, Kyle Chandler (27) of North Berwick, ME crossed the line second overall (first truck), with Kristopher Knox (0) of Sanford, ME, Matthew Mains (88) of Kennebunk, ME, Ryan Turcotte (30) of Lebanon, ME, and Aaron Chandler (74) of Gray, ME completing the order.

Heat race wins went to Milton Duran (Super Streets), Cam Huntress (Super Streets), Gage Osborne (Ridge Runners), Brian Caswell (Ridge Runners), and Shane Webber (Trucks/Bugs).
